They just updated my laptop - now a proud member of the x-series family. Quick question on power supplies....

So it looks like the power supply for my t60p is compatible (from a plug in perspective) with the x61s. X-series PS is rated 65W/20V/3.25A. T-series PS is rated 90W/20V/4.5A. Since I pack both laptops with me but only run one at a time - is it safe to use the t60p power supply with a x61s? Would be nice to carry one less thing, but hate to do something dangerous just because the socket fits....
